Carrie Lederer is the quintessential one-woman band filmmaker, nicknamed “Carrier Pigeon” for her global reach and decades of on-the-ground storytelling. Her multi-decade career spans unscripted television for major networks, independent documentaries, and nonprofit-driven social impact films across a wide range of genres and locations. Combining cinematographic expertise with journalistic instinct, she creates immersive, human-centered narratives and builds deep connections with the people she documents. Now based in Portland, Oregon, Carrie returns to documentary filmmaking with her short directorial debut, Wild Horses at the Door.
